What WhatsApp Can Do
WhatsApp voice and video calls are free between WhatsApp users. You can call internationally at no charge as long as both people have the app installed and an active internet connection. Calls use your Wi-Fi or mobile data — not your phone plan's minutes.
For calling friends and family who are on WhatsApp, it's hard to beat free.

WhatsApp uses roughly 0.3–0.5 MB of data per minute for voice calls and up to 5 MB for video. It works over Wi-Fi or mobile data, supports group calls with up to 32 people, and is available on Android, iPhone, and desktop. Does WhatsApp Charge for International Calls?
No — WhatsApp-to-WhatsApp calls are free worldwide. However, your mobile carrier may charge you for the data used during the call if you're not on Wi-Fi. A one-minute WhatsApp voice call uses roughly 0.3–0.5 MB of data. On most plans, this is negligible.

When You Need More Than WhatsApp
These are the most common situations where you need a WhatsApp alternative to call a real number.
Calling family on a landline
Your grandmother in India, your uncle in Nigeria, your parents in the Philippines — if they have a landline or a basic mobile without internet, WhatsApp can't reach them.
Calling a bank from abroad
You're traveling and your card gets blocked. Your bank's customer service is a phone number, not a WhatsApp contact. Toll-free numbers don't work from abroad at all.
Calling a business or government office
Embassies, airlines, hospitals, insurance companies — they all operate on traditional phone lines.
Calling areas with poor internet
In many parts of Africa, South Asia, and rural Latin America, internet access is unreliable. A regular phone call gets through when WhatsApp can't.
